What airports do you fly into for Boulder from Santa Ana?
From Santa Ana, you can connect to Boulder through Boulder, CO (WBU-Boulder Municipal), Denver Intl. Airport (DEN) and Broomfield, CO (BJC-Rocky Mountain Metropolitan). It’s wise to check which terminal works best for you before making your decision. If you settle on Boulder, CO (WBU-Boulder Municipal), it’s around 3 mi northeast of the city center.
